Andrew Dalton
Livestock Consultant, Auctioneer
Andrew Dalton has been a valued member of the Charles Stewart Howard team for the past six years and brings more than 13 years of experience as an Auctioneer and Livestock Agent. Raised on a farm near Bunbartha, Andrew has grown up with a strong connection to agriculture.
As a regular auctioneer at the weekly cattle market at the Colac Livestock Selling Centre, Andrew enjoys the opportunity to work closely with producers and buyers across the region. His role also takes him far beyond the saleyards, with work ranging from mustering goats and cattle in Cobar, New South Wales, to attending livestock sales in Echuca, Shepparton, Dubbo and as far north as Roma, Queensland.
